Output d69944dce93341c11a869fc19ec5d72369d29039df5e43cc976379b1050e72f2:1

value
130000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508c11900189a313080211638e5f7c23aedf8dab OP_EQUALVERIFY OP_CHECKSIG
address
18LtrV3vdftp1hXhu5cJWPe5d1BDHpJAv8
transaction
d69944dce93341c11a869fc19ec5d72369d29039df5e43cc976379b1050e72f2
confirmations
287354
spent
true